Upload above, review the predicted size for each of three quality levels, pick, download. Re-encoding uses H.264 + AAC, so the result plays everywhere the original did.
Phone and screen recordings typically shrink 60–85% at level 2 with little visible difference. The prediction shows your exact numbers before you commit.
Not unless necessary — bitrate drops first; resolution steps down only at aggressive levels where keeping it would look worse.
Multi-GB files are fine — processing runs server-side in a queue, and failed jobs are never billed.
